Hackney Carriage Licences - Unmet Demand Survey PDF 70 KB Report of the Head of Legal, HR and Democratic Services detailing a report by the Halcrow Group Ltd concerning Hackney Carriage demand in relation to the City Council’s current policy of numerical control of the number of Hackney Carriage Licences issued, attached.
Additional documents:
Minutes:
The Committee considered the report of the Head of Legal, HR and Democratic Services setting out a report by the Halcrow Group Limited, concerning Hackney Carriage demand in relation to the City Council’s current policy of numerical control of the number of Hackney Carriage licences issued. (Copy of the report circulated with the agenda and appended to he signed minutes).
The Committee received a presentation by Ms L Richardson from the Halcrow Group, providing details of the study conducted.
Members of the trade and representatives of the Southampton Hackney Carriage Association, the Southampton Taxi Association and Unite Cab Section were present and with the consent of the Chair, Mr Johnson, Mr Perry, Mr Hall and Mr S Afzal, addressed the meeting.
The following was noted:-
The Committee accepted legal advice that when making their decision it was important that they did not base it only on the unmet demand figures, but that relevant Government Guidance, attached as Appendix 2 to the report, should also be taken into consideration. This was considered carefully but local factors as identified in the report felt to outweigh the Guidance in this instance.
Councillor Parnell put forward the following proposal, seconded by Councillor Thomas which was unanimously adopted:-
RESOLVED that having taken into consideration the reports, presentation, comments and relevant government guidance, the number of licensed hackney carriages should continue to be restricted to 283.
